Simultaneous multi-USB interface: Enables real-time capture and analysis of low, full, and high-speed USB traffic for deep protocol-level insights
FPGA-based device emulation: Allows rapid prototyping and creation of custom USB devices using open-source tools and Python
Transparent USB packet manipulation: Supports MITM attacks and real-time data tampering for advanced security testing and research
Open-source ecosystem: Provides a mature suite of open-source software, gateware, and hardware for analysis, development, and experimentation
Robust CNC-milled aluminum enclosure: Ensures durability and protection while maintaining a compact, lightweight design

Making USB Accessible
Cynthion is an all-in-one tool for building, testing, monitoring, and experimenting with USB devices. Built around a unique FPGA-based architecture, Cynthion's digital hardware can be fully customized to suit the application at hand.
